// WikiGate RBAC client setup.
// Roles are resolved server-side; do not cache grants locally for
// more than 60s or edit-lock checks drift. On-call: if page saves
// fail with 403, the role sync job on Hollowpine is likely stuck —
// kick it before touching anything else. Client auths with the
// internal RBAC key, which follows on the next line.

app token of yagaf-bahop = vxb2-4d

Attendees: Priya Velth, Oskar Dunmore, Lena Carrick.

Quick recap for the sales leads: the proposed joint venture with Marrowfield Instruments got a cautious thumbs-up. Oskar flagged overlap with our Quillbrook line, and Lena wants clearer revenue-split terms before we commit. Next step is a joint workshop in Elderbay to hash out territories — sales leads should come prepared with pipeline numbers. Don't circulate this beyond the group yet. The board's current thinking on the venture is noted below.

internal memo for bajep-yajeg: The steering committee signed off on a budget of $152.1 million for Project Ulaius.

## Ownership

Sprigloop is the little scheduler that decides when the office plants get watered. It's small but people notice fast when it breaks (RIP the lobby fern, never forget). If you want to add a plant profile or tweak the moisture thresholds, open a PR and tag the maintainer listed below.

signatory, tahop-taweg: Pelmir Oliys

14:22 — Incremental rebuild pipeline on Hollyport docs began emitting stale pages after a cache-key collision in the Brindlegen fingerprinter. Duplicate keys caused unchanged output for 312 edited pages. Detected by Jori via broken changelog links. Mitigation: cache flushed, full rebuild forced at 14:41; stale pages purged from CDN by 14:55. Collision traced to truncated content hashes. The offending build is identified by the token below.

session token of tajef-bageg = htk21_5d90d574934f3ccae6437